About This Show

New York choreographer Scott Rink evokes a macabre world gone mad, based on the images of post-WWI German Expressionist painters and set to the early theater songs of Kurt Weill. Rink and Lenna Parr portray an array of characters through dance and movement accompanied by the haunting sounds of singer Jack Donahue. Of Melodrama and Murder is part of the Philadelphia Fringe Festival.
